Authority: National Company Law Tribunal, Division Bench, Court - 1, Ahmedabad
Order Date: 12/06/2026
Case Overview
The application was filed by SVC Co-Operative Bank Ltd (formerly known as Shamrao Vithal Cooperative Bank Ltd) as the Financial Creditor under Section 95(1) of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code, 2016. The proceedings are against MaheshKumar Udesinhbhai Parmar, who is the Personal Guarantor of corporate debtor M/s Sahar Industries LLP. The application seeks initiation of Insolvency Resolution Process under Rule 7(2) of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y (Application to Adjudicating Authority for Insolvency Resolution Process for Personal Guarantors to Corporate Debtor) Rules, 2019.
The tribunal heard arguments from Mr. Sumit Parikh, Advocate representing the Applicant/Financial Creditor. The respondent/personal guarantor was not represented during these proceedings. The Financial Creditor proposed the appointment of Sun Resolution Professionals Pvt. Ltd. as the Interim Resolution Professional (IRP), having Registration Number: IBBI/IPE-0064/IPA-1/2023-24/50043. The tribunal verified that the AFA (Authorized Financial Advisor) of the proposed IRP is valid until 30.06.2026.
Final Outcome
The NCLT appointed Sun Resolution Professionals Pvt. Ltd. as the IRP for the respondent/personal guarantor. The IRP is directed to submit a report under Section 99 of the IBC, 2016 within ten days. The IRP is required to examine the application as set out in Section 97(6) of IBC, 2016 and after examination, may recommend either acceptance or rejection of the application in its report as per Section 97(7). The report must be filed through a separate IA in this matter after serving copies to both the respondent/personal guarantor and the corporate debtor. The applicant/financial creditor is directed to serve a copy of this order and the petition to the IRP within three days for preparing the Section 99 report. All challenges to the application are to be considered at the time when necessary orders under Section 100 of the IBC are passed. The matter is posted for next hearing on 10/07/2026 for consideration of the IRP's report.
